Hello,

This design does use 18ct. White Aida. Our default is set to 14ct. so it never got changed when the supplies were added. I have changed the fabric count and I double checked the floss list and that is correct. Sorry for the confusion and thanks for letting us know about the error :)

I like to precut my skeins into eight equal lengths, then I thread them onto card stock with holes punched in it. I used to get the cards at Hobby Lobby, but for political reasons, I don't shop there anymore. I make my own cards now. I had a ton of floss from old projects like this and couldn't think of a good way to organize them all. But I did finally get a system and I can use old floss now. I will probably check my old floss before buying more for this project. I just talk big, lol. I had all the colors at one point rolled onto the flat bobbins, but I prefer to have the floss precut and without kinks.
